Technology Process of C22H24N4O3

There total 7 articles about C22H24N4O3 which guide to synthetic route it. synthetic route:
Guidance literature:
diethyl 1-cyanomethylphosphonate; With sodium hydride; In 1,2-dimethoxyethane; at 0 ℃; for 0.333333h; Inert atmosphere;
C20H23N3O4; In 1,2-dimethoxyethane; at 0 - 30 ℃; for 2.5h; Inert atmosphere;
Guidance literature:
Multi-step reaction with 5 steps
1.1: sodium azide / water; acetone / 16 h / 50 °C / Large scale
1.2: 1 h / Large scale
2.1: hydrogenchloride / ethanol / 5 h / 83 °C / Large scale
3.1: sodium hydride / N,N-dimethyl-formamide / 0.75 h / -25 °C / Inert atmosphere
3.2: 2.2 h / 25 °C / Inert atmosphere
4.1: lithium tri-t-butoxyaluminum hydride / tetrahydrofuran / 3.5 h / -20 - 30 °C / Inert atmosphere
5.1: sodium hydride / 1,2-dimethoxyethane / 0.33 h / 0 °C / Inert atmosphere
5.2: 2.5 h / 0 - 30 °C / Inert atmosphere
With hydrogenchloride; sodium azide; sodium hydride; lithium tri-t-butoxyaluminum hydride; In tetrahydrofuran; 1,2-dimethoxyethane; ethanol; water; N,N-dimethyl-formamide; acetone;
Guidance literature:
Multi-step reaction with 3 steps
1.1: sodium hydride / N,N-dimethyl-formamide / 0.75 h / -25 °C / Inert atmosphere
1.2: 2.2 h / 25 °C / Inert atmosphere
2.1: lithium tri-t-butoxyaluminum hydride / tetrahydrofuran / 3.5 h / -20 - 30 °C / Inert atmosphere
3.1: sodium hydride / 1,2-dimethoxyethane / 0.33 h / 0 °C / Inert atmosphere
3.2: 2.5 h / 0 - 30 °C / Inert atmosphere
With sodium hydride; lithium tri-t-butoxyaluminum hydride; In tetrahydrofuran; 1,2-dimethoxyethane; N,N-dimethyl-formamide;
